Read the silhouette first.

Shape tells you the kind of message before words become legible. Color narrows it further. Learn those cues, then work through all 98 positions on the California DMV DL-37 chart.

01 · inference

Shape first. Color second. Words last.

These are category cues, not permission to ignore a sign's exact symbol or legend.
